Climate Overview

The climate in Humaitá is hot. The average annual temperature is 27°C and approximately 2616mm of precipitation falls per year. December is the wettest month, receiving around 457mm of rainfall. Humaitá sits near the equator, so seasonal temperature differences are minimal throughout the year.

Precipitation

Humaitá is a very wet location, receiving approximately 2616mm of precipitation annually, which averages out to around 218mm per month. The wettest month is December, averaging 457mm of rainfall. January and March also tend to see above-average precipitation. The driest month is July, with just 18mm. That's 439mm less than December, the wettest month. Rainfall is heavily concentrated in certain months, creating a distinct wet and dry season. Visitors should plan around these patterns, as the difference between peak and low months is dramatic.
